2 hours ago, zordinary said:

but cant deal with BMs and Summoners (i prob dont know how to fight summoners but so far i burst their pets down with huge fire spells then kill them, worked a few times, and then try to avoid being CCed, but when i do get CCed they just walk out of my camera angel and 100 to 0 me in idk 10 seconds or something, and seems like second wind cant get me out of that green root thing. but does putting 2 points into SS do the trick?) 

You always do 2 points into SS. It's a stun/KD escape, I can't imagine a build without. 

 

Also, your Q and E escape root/vine (or freeze from fellow FMs)

At 45, in the Brightstone area there is a small section called Misty Woods in the south west corner.  This has a Cerulean and Crimson camp area.  Put on your faction suit and kill the opposite faction NPCs and spawn their "bosses" Kill them and loot their insignia bundles.  Open the bundles and you get a random amount 1-4 insignia's which you can turn into your camp for Moonwater Arena soul shield.  

 

This soul shield will put you 35k-40k HP and have nice crit defense and other stats.  It is helpful for open world PVP

 

For summoners, I snatch their pet and put it to sleep with blackout.  Then chase down the summoner and burst it down ( use your divine veil to block their range attacks )
